Roasted Salmon With Spinach
Total Time: 20 mins
Preparation Time: 5 mins
Cook Time: 15 mins
Ingredients
- Servings: 4
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, plus 
- 3 tablespoons unsalted butter 
- 1 teaspoon dry crushed red pepper 
- 1 clove garlic, minced 
- 1 1/2 tablespoons minced ginger (fresh) 
- 1/2 cup packed golden brown sugar 
- 1/2 cup fresh lime juice 
- 1/2 cup soy sauce 
- 2 teaspoons cornstarch, dissolved in 
- 2 teaspoons water 
- 4 (7 ounce) salmon fillets 
- 2 (6 -9 ounce) bags baby spinach (depending how much spinach you want) 
- 2 cups cooked rice 
Recipe
- 1 preheat oven to 400°f. 
- 2 melt 1/2 cup butter in heavy large saucepan over medium heat. 
- 3 add crushed red pepper, ginger, and garlic and stir until fragrant, about 1 minute. 
- 4 add sugar; whisk until mixture is melted and smooth and begins to bubble, about 4 minutes. 
- 5 whisk in lime juice and soy sauce. 
- 6 increase heat and boil until reduced to 1 1/2 cups, about 2 minutes. 
- 7 add cornstarch mixture and boil until thick, about 3 minutes. 
- 8 set sauce aside. 
- 9 melt 1 tablespoon butter in heavy large skillet over high heat. 
- 10 working in batches, cook salmon until golden brown, about 2 minutes per side. 
- 11 transfer to baking sheet. 
- 12 spoon 1 tablespoon sauce over each fillet. 
- 13 roast until fish is opaque in center, about 5 minutes. 
- 14 melt remaining 2 tablespoons butter in large pot over medium-high heat. 
- 15 add spinach and toss until wilted but still bright green, about 3 minutes. 
- 16 season to taste with salt and pepper. 
- 17 divide rice among four plates. 
- 18 using tongs, top rice with spinach. 
- 19 top each with salmon fillet; drizzle with remaining sauce and serve.
